Higher Virasoro modes are... grunt 53 lyricsWebOct 3, 2012 · Statistical thermodynamics of the dimers lattice models has a long history. This is one of the earliest lattice models which take into account the own size of molecules in the frame of the lattice gas model. Apparently, the first model of the dimer has been studied in the context of the entropy of the adlayer in 1937 [ 40 ]. final counter offerWebSep 1, 2011 · We perform numerical transfer-matrix calculations to determine a global phase diagram, and also estimate the central charge in the critical phase.
